We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Project Manager with a specialism in Project Planning to join our programme management function.
You’ll be supporting large programmes across a number of projects, technologies and activities in support of MTC clients within the defence sector.
Your responsibilities will be split across both project management and project planning aspects of the role as required.
This role will require an experienced Project Manager who currently holds UKSV clearance or be willing to attain this.
As a Project manager you will:
Lead and manage the successful delivery of a number of projects working across various MTC Technology Themes for major MTC clients.
Ensure the customer and all stakeholders needs are clearly captured, understood, and effectively built into the project scope, and all aspects of project delivery.
Liaise with resource owners / team leaders to ensure effective use of resources in delivering project quality, cost & delivery within project scope.
Manage any changes to project scope via the recognised “Change Request” process.
Define, measure and report regular updates of project performance to the client, senior management and key stakeholders.
Work closely with technical leads.
Act as champion for project management processes, tools & techniques.
Contribute to continuous improvement activities relates to PM tools and processes.
Offer clear and concise communication given in a timely manner to key stakeholders, ensuring they are briefed on any mission critical issues and remedial plans are fully agreed.
As a Project Planning specialist you will:
Developing and managing schedules ensuring its quality (logic, clarity) and accuracy (update of dates, progress, and scope definition).
Collaborating with the responsible project manager as well as with the execution functions (engineering, procurement, workshop/operations, etc) to ensure the full project scope and requirements are captured and baselined within the programme.
Developing and providing relevant reports
Interact with the customer (internal as well as potentially external) to provide updates
Ensuring that the contract programme is produced, maintained submitted in accordance with contractual requirements.
Experience across all stages of the project life cycle in medium to large sized projects.
Development and implementation of planning processes, policies, and procedures.
